Subject: Warranty Cost Overrun — Q3 Review

Team,

Warranty claims on the Voltrane HX series have exceeded our accrual by roughly 18% this quarter, driven largely by compressor seal failures reported out of the Kellmore region. Sales leads should note that extended-warranty pricing will be adjusted pending a root-cause report from the Danforth plant, expected within three weeks. Please hold off on quoting multi-year coverage until revised rates are issued. The following should stay within this group.

internal memo for hahaf-kahof: Only 39 of the 428 pilot accounts renewed Sorion, so a churn review is set for April 12. Praokix Freight is in early talks to buy Queniusox Group for about $145.8 million.

For the sales leads: our commercial policy renewal with Meridale Assurance has been negotiated at a 7% premium increase, against an initial quote of 15%. Coverage limits on goods-in-transit rise to match the expanded Kestrel product line, and the deductible structure is unchanged. Claims history over the past two years was favorable, which helped the negotiation considerably. Please factor the revised cost allocation into territory margin plans. The confidential note below explains the strategic reasoning behind accepting these terms.

internal memo for yahag-tahog: The pricing group signed off on a budget of $152.8 million for Project Soriel.

## Runbook: Stockmend Reconciliation Job

Stockmend reconciles warehouse counts against the Cartwheel order ledger nightly at 02:10. If the job stalls, check the Halvorsen queue depth first; anything over 50k pending deltas means upstream ingest is behind, not the job itself. Restarts are safe — the job is idempotent and checkpoints every 10k rows. Escalate only if two consecutive runs fail. When filing an incident, always include the build token shown below.

pipeline stamp: htk3_69f

## Env vars: canary gating (Bramblegate)

Canary promotion in Bramblegate is gated by error-rate and latency checks. CANARY_WINDOW=10m, CANARY_MAX_ERR=0.5. Gates run against the Thornquist metrics API, which requires authentication. Never promote manually while a gate is evaluating. The metrics API secret is set on the line directly below.

sealed setting: VAULT_KEY20=c8ea1e419912889df6b4